Commissioners described a proposed Emergency Service District (ESD) for the Preston Peninsula and urged residents to research the petition election; the county judge said the court previously approved sending the proposal to an election and noted the county currently supplements fire/EMS with roughly $2.9 million annually.

Commissioners discussed a proposed Emergency Service District (ESD) that would cover the Preston Peninsula and told residents to gather facts ahead of a petition election.

"It's been an eventful week, weekend. There's the first proposed ESD for Grayson County in the Preston Peninsula," Commissioner Hardenberg said, urging neighbors to research the proposal and make an informed decision.
